Page 43 - Every will, other than a nuncupative will, must be in writing, and every will, other than an olographic or a nuncupative will, must be executed and attested as follows: (1) it must be subscribed at the end thereof by the testator himself; (2) the subscription must be made in the presence of the attesting witnesses...
